23 / 33 page ![]() Audio Subsystem with Mono Class D Speaker and Class H Headphone Amplifier 23 I2C Registers Nine internal registers program the MAX97000. Table 1 lists all the registers, their addresses, and power-on- reset states. Register 0xFF indicates the device revision. Write zeros to all unused bits in the register table when updating the register, unless otherwise noted. Tables 2 through 7 describe each bit. Table 1. Register Map Table 2. Configures the input A channel as either a mono differential signal (INA = INA2 - INA1) or as a stereo signal (INA1 = left, INA2 = right). 0 = Stereo single-ended 1 = Differential 6 INBDIFF Input B Differential Mode. Configures the input B channel as either a mono differential signal (INB = INB2 - INB1) or as a stereo signal (INB1 = left, INB2 = right). 0 = Stereo single-ended 1 = Differential 5 PGAINA Input A Preamp Gain. Set the input gain to maximize output signal level for a given input signal range to improve the SNR of the system. PGAINA = 111 switches to a trimmed 20kI feedback resistor for external gain setting. 4 VALUE 000 001 010 011 100 101 110 111 LEVEL (dB) -6 -3 0 3 6 9 18 External 3 |
